Transaction 80d43a7dd76b32360fbb58a309bba7e2f9d4c932d4fa04b25595d6207b6c1ea1
1 Input
1 Output
-
80d43a7dd76b32360fbb58a309bba7e2f9d4c932d4fa04b25595d6207b6c1ea1:0
- value
- 563661
- script pubkey
- OP_0 OP_PUSHBYTES_20 621f59427fa917154e40eaaba3db5c83e63126e0
- address
- bc1qvg04jsnl4yt32njqa2468k6us0nrzfhq25cffs